The invention discloses an autonomous elevator riding system for a mobile robot. The autonomous elevator riding system comprises an elevator button pressing module which is adapted to be mounted on anelevator floor control panel; and the elevator button pressing module is in wireless communication with the mobile robot and is adapted to press corresponding elevator buttons on the elevator floor control panel according to instructions sent by the mobile robot to call an elevator car. In the system, the mobile robot can ride the elevator autonomously through the autonomous elevator riding system for the mobile robot. Therefore, the application range of the robot is expanded, the elevator itself does not need to be changed, and the safety of the elevator is not affected.
